Obituary for Vernell Childs Guy

Vernell Childs Guy was born on August 20, 1935, in San Antonio, Texas to the late Tom Childs and Ida Rodriguez Childs. Vernell accepted Christ as a teenager at the Denver Heights Church of God In Christ. She continued her Christian journey attending Greater Evangelist Temple Church of God In Christ. Vernell was under the spiritual leadership of the three pastors of Greater Evangelist Temple Church of God In Christ, Elder Bev Anthony, Supt. C.W. Steward and Pastor Verell L. Nelson. Mother Guy was an active member of the church. She served in the choir, on the Mother’s Board, and she taught Junior Church. She also served by being the sanctuary housekeeper. Vernell received her early education in the San Antonio Private School System. She attended Holy Redeemer School for Girls, ranking within the top 10% of her class. She was also offered an opportunity to become a nun. Vernell continued her education by attending St. Phillips Community College. Upon graduating, she earned her degree in Nursing. After 35 years of dedicated service, Mother Guy officially retired from the Robert B. Green Hospital. Prior to that she was employed as a private duty nurse and worked in the Hospitality Industry. Mother Guy was saved, sanctified, and filled with the holy ghost. The outward manifestation of her love for Christ was not limited to the confines of the church. Mother has been known to be in complete praise mode at work, in the grocery store, at home and even when driving. Her worn, torn, tattered bible was always within arm’s reach. Mother Guy lived the life that she preached. Being a virtuous woman, she strategically implemented effective witnessing as the cornerstone of her ministry. She was well respected in the community, well loved by family and friends, and well versed in godly living. Mother Guy was avid supporter of Testimonies of God’s Greatness. Vernell was married to Joseph Guy Sr. This union remained as one until his demise. Mother was preceded in death by her sons Joseph and Gregory Guy, parents, Tom Childs and Ida Rodriguez Childs, brothers, Tommy, David, Henry, Eddie, and Daniel, sisters, Fern, Mildred, Melrose, and Vivian. She leaves to cherish her memories her daughters, Gayle Hamilton and Joy Guy Blake of San Antonio. Vernell’s grandchildren, great-grandchildren, great- great- grandchildren, nieces, nephews, relatives, and friends will also cherish fond memories of her. She will be remembered by her Greater Evangelist Temple Church of God in Christ family as a faithful member.
